Zenless Zone Zero is an all-new 3D action game from HoYoverse, here to provide a thrilling combat experience. Build a squad of up to three and begin your assault with Basic and Special Attacks. Dodge and Parry to neutralize your opponents' counterattacks, and when they're Stunned, unleash a powerful combo of Chain Attacks to finish them off! Remember, different opponents have different traits, and it would be prudent to use their weaknesses to your advantage. Read less

Release dates

  • Jan 29, 2024 (Beta) (Worldwide) Android
  • May 27, 2024 (Beta) (Worldwide) iOS
  • Jun 20, 2024 (Full Release) (Worldwide) Android
  • Jul 02, 2024 (Full Release) (Worldwide) iOS
  • Jul 04, 2024 (Full Release) (Worldwide) PC (Microsoft Windows), PlayStation 5
  • Jun 06, 2025 (Full Release) (Worldwide) Xbox Series X|S

Playtime: 3h17m

Intro

This is a fighting game with a ton of nonsense stacked on top.

The Good

  • Fights look really cool.
  • It's free.
  • 10% less child porn than Genshin Impact

The Bad

  • I unlocked 4 characters and half of them made me uncomfortable.
  • Time isn't free.
  • Boring story.
  • Uninteresting characters.
  • Combat is actually pretty basic.

The Ugly

  • Logging in takes over a minute and you have to click twice with ~10 seconds in between.
  • Exiting the game without using Alt+F4 takes 4 clicks and waiting for a slow menu to load. Lol.
  • Super predatory monetisation.
  • Most of the twenty different menu's consist of icons.
  • There are at least three different daily reward structures plus other F2P nonsense.
  • You have to walk around a small map, sit through menus and dialogue, move around on a 2D map and do the hokey-pokey before you're actually allowed to fight like two whole fights and the entire sequence repeats.
  • Seriously, between all the rewards, walking, talking, et cetera the actual fighting gameplay is like 25% of the game.

The Japanese

  • One of the characters looks like a kid and makes porn sounds.

Conclusion

Cool combat visuals, awful everything else.

One of the update notes for version 1.1:

A button for "Manual Chain Attack" mode will be added to the squad lineup interface before entering combat. In this mode, after Stunning an enemy, your actions will not trigger other Agents' Chain Attacks. Additionally, a "Cancel Chain Attack Combo" function will be added to combat, allowing you to choose whether to use the "Manual Chain Attack" mode according to your preferences.

This seems antithetical to the current flow of combat and to what I think makes the combat in this game interesting. It’s feels like the people complaining just want more conventional combat and I hope miHoYo doesn’t listen to the players when making every decision about mechanics.

This is whisky. If you know your limits, have rules and enjoy responsabily then you'll have fun. It's does a few things and it does them well: character design, art and style.

If you are an alcoholic, avoid it at all costs. But note, there is the chance that this games turns you into an alcoholic - a small one.

This game's style is so fun, the world is magical. But i can't imagine playing the game for longer than 5 hours. That's because unlike starrail there is no new areas to explore. So you end up feeling like you are stuck in a really nice box. (release impression)

*A year later the game is in a much better spot. A lot more characters, double banners so more choice, and a bit less stingy. Getting to endgame content is a bit annoying, but once you are there the game feels really nice and the systems click toghther.

Going through the story will have you play with most of the characters. So you'll have a good idea if the game is worth your time.

I have a massive issue with how slow the dialogue is to progress. I read fast. I would rather there is no skip option and I can speed through. But at least there is a skip option. The static conversations are just far to mediocre and tendious.

I think that this game would have benefited from a 'less is more' approach to the story telling and only have the AA and AAA tier cutscenes. The A tier stuff is just... pointless.
